Ticket DBX-2290: Read-replica lag alarm keeps firing on the Copperwell cluster. Hey, welcome aboard — quick context: the alarm threshold was set to 5 seconds back when traffic was tiny, and now the nightly batch jobs blow past it every time. Proposal is to bump the threshold to 30 seconds and add a separate page-worthy alert at 5 minutes. Change is low-risk but touches production alerting, so it can't ship on a contractor's approval alone. It needs sign-off from the alerting owner.

named custodian: Oliath Ralax

Hi, and welcome to the Sproutly on-call rotation! Quick context for your review: the plant-watering scheduler runs as a single worker that reads greenhouse sensor data and dispatches valve commands over an authenticated channel. The main things to watch are stuck schedules (valves left open) and clock drift on the edge units, both of which page automatically. Credentials for the dispatcher rotate weekly, which you'll probably want to look at first. All the scheduler internals and alert definitions are documented on the page below.

operations page: https://jenkins.zemvarcloud.local/job/merge_requests/repo/build/73930b4b30f0a8ed

## Environments: Cold Starts

Quillback handlers run in three environments: dev, staging, prod. Cold starts differ sharply. Dev freezes aggressively; expect a cold start on nearly every invocation. Staging keeps two warm instances. Prod pre-warms based on traffic forecasts, so plugin init code should still complete under 400 ms. Plugins must not cache connections across invocations in dev. Do not assume warm state anywhere. Timeouts and concurrency caps vary per environment. The current per-environment settings are listed below.

settings of fafog-haduf:
ZORIX_PIN=4648
ZORIX_METRICS_HOST=metrics.zorix.paliqsys.corp
ZORIX_LOG_LEVEL=info
ZORIX_TENANT=druix

Alert: build-agent-clock-skew

This fires when any Coppermill build agent drifts more than 90 seconds from the fleet median. Usually it's agent cm-old-07 after a reboot — its NTP config is cursed and nobody's fixed it properly. Skew breaks artifact timestamps and cache keys, so don't snooze it. Restart chronyd first; if drift persists, drain the agent and ping the infra rotation at the address below.

pager mailbox: silael.sorwyn.tamius@zemvarsys.corp